What are the key features of ISO7731FDWR?
- 3-channel isolation (2+1) with 150Mbps max data rate
- 5kVrms reinforced isolation, wide 2.25V-5.5V supply, <13ns propagation delay
- Industrial -40 to 125C range, RoHS compliant, fail-safe outputs in SOIC-16
What is ISO7731FDWR used for?
Widely used in industrial automation, motor drives, and grid-tied inverters for isolating SPI/digital control signals across power domains. Also suitable for medical equipment isolation barriers and gate driver interfaces in EV charging systems.
What are the specifications of ISO7731FDWR?
| Isolation Voltage | 5000Vrms |
| Number of Channels | 3 |
| Max Data Rate | 150Mbps |
| Supply Voltage | 2.25 to 5.5V |
| Propagation Delay | 13ns |
| Operating Temperature | -40 to 125°C |
| Package | SOIC-16 |

Frequently Asked Questions
What is the isolation voltage of ISO7731FDWR?
The ISO7731FDWR provides 5000Vrms reinforced isolation per UL 1577 and IEC 61010-1, making it suitable for industrial and medical applications requiring high-voltage barrier separation.
What package and pin count does ISO7731FDWR use?
ISO7731FDWR comes in a 16-pin SOIC-16 wide-body package. The FDWR suffix specifically denotes this wide SOIC package, with a standard 1.27mm pitch for easy PCB assembly.
What is the maximum data rate of ISO7731FDWR?
ISO7731FDWR supports a maximum data rate of 150Mbps, enabling it to isolate high-speed SPI, digital I/O, and control signals without significant timing degradation.
What are common applications for ISO7731FDWR?
ISO7731FDWR is commonly used in industrial motor drives, grid inverters, PLC I/O modules, EV charging stations, and medical instrumentation where digital signals must cross high-voltage isolation boundaries.
What are compatible alternatives to ISO7731FDWR?
Compatible alternatives include the ADuM3301 from Analog Devices (3-channel, similar isolation rating) and the Si8631 from Silicon Labs, both offering equivalent 3-channel digital isolation in comparable packages.
